Fodor's Review:

Temecula Valley Museum, adjacent to Sam Hicks Monument Park, focuses on Temecula Valley history, including early Native American life, Butterfield stage routes, and the ranchero period. A hands-on interactive area for children holds a general store, photographer's studio, and ride-a-pony station. Outside there's a playground and picnic area.

  • Cost: $2 suggested donation
  • Open: Tues.-Sat. 10-4, Sun. 1-4
